Introduction to Pumpkin Spice Latte
The Pumpkin Spice Latte is a fall-themed drink made with espresso, steamed milk, and a blend of spices, including cinnamon, nutmeg, and cloves. The drink is typically topped with whipped cream and pumpkin pie spice. The PSL has been a staple on the menus of coffee shops, particularly Starbucks, since its introduction in 2003. Its popularity can be attributed to its unique flavor profile, which combines the warmth of spices with the richness of espresso and milk.
Ingredients and Flavor Profile
The PSL is made with a combination of ingredients, including espresso, steamed milk, pumpkin puree, and a blend of spices. The espresso provides a strong, rich flavor, while the steamed milk adds a creamy texture. The pumpkin puree adds a subtle sweetness and a hint of pumpkin flavor, while the spices provide warmth and depth. The flavor profile of the PSL is complex and multifaceted, with notes of cinnamon, nutmeg, and cloves.
Role of Coffee in PSL
While the PSL is often associated with coffee, the flavor of the drink is not dominated by coffee. In fact, the espresso is often overpowered by the sweetness of the pumpkin puree and the spices. However, the espresso still plays a crucial role in the flavor profile of the PSL, providing a rich and velvety texture. The coffee flavor is subtle, but it adds depth and complexity to the drink.

Can you taste the pumpkin in a Pumpkin Spice Latte?
While the name “Pumpkin Spice Latte” might suggest that the drink contains a strong pumpkin flavor, the reality is that the pumpkin flavor is actually quite subtle. The PSL typically contains a small amount of pumpkin puree or pumpkin flavoring, which adds a subtle sweetness and depth to the drink. However, the pumpkin flavor is not the dominant note in a PSL, and it is often overpowered by the spices and sweet flavors.
The pumpkin flavor in a PSL is more of a background note, adding a subtle warmth and depth to the drink. The spices, such as cinnamon, nutmeg, and cloves, are the dominant flavors in a PSL, and they help to create a warm and comforting taste experience. While the pumpkin flavor is present, it is not the main attraction. Instead, it helps to enhance and balance out the other flavors in the drink, creating a unique and delicious taste experience.
